I'm pretty new to Kubernetes and I have to create a pod using Kubernetes python-client. So to experiment around I'm trying to run examples notebooks provided by the project without any change to see how things works.
Starting with intro_notebook.ipynb at 3rd step I get an error:
ValueError: Invalid value for `selector`, must not be `None`
Here is the code:
from kubernetes import client, config
The only part I've changed is the second cell, because I'm running Kubernetes using Ubuntu's microk8s:
config.load_kube_config('/var/snap/microk8s/current/credentials/client.config')
api_instance = client.AppsV1Api()
dep = client.V1Deployment()
spec = client.V1DeploymentSpec() # <<< At this line I hit the error!

It's because they changed the validation to happen in the constructor, rather that later -- which is not what the notebook was expecting. They You just need to move those inner assignments up to be valid before constructing the Deployment:
name = "my-busybox"
spec = client.V1DeploymentSpec(
selector=client.V1LabelSelector(match_labels={"app":"busybox"}),
template=client.V1PodTemplateSpec(),
)
container = client.V1Container(
image="busybox:1.26.1",
args=["sleep", "3600"],
name=name,
)
spec.template.metadata = client.V1ObjectMeta(
name="busybox",
labels={"app":"busybox"},
)
spec.template.spec = client.V1PodSpec(containers = [container])
dep = client.V1Deployment(
metadata=client.V1ObjectMeta(name=name),
spec=spec,
)
